Web15 Feb 2024 · Although more research is highlighting how BPD causes significant personal issues, such as disruption to education, work, or personal life, those with less socially … WebBorderline personality disorder (BPD) can cause a wide range of symptoms, which can be broadly grouped into 4 main areas. The 4 areas are: emotional instability – the psychological term for this is "affective dysregulation". disturbed patterns of thinking or perception – "cognitive distortions" or "perceptual distortions".
